Fluoxetine + magnesium refers to the co-administration of fluoxetine, a selective serotonin reuptake inhibitor (SSRI) antidepressant, and magnesium, an essential mineral often used as a dietary supplement. Fluoxetine acts by inhibiting the reuptake of serotonin in the brain, thereby increasing its availability and improving mood in conditions such as major depressive disorder, obsessive-compulsive disorder, bulimia nervosa, panic disorder, and premenstrual dysphoric disorder. Magnesium is involved in numerous physiological processes including nerve transmission and muscle contraction; it is commonly supplemented to prevent or treat magnesium deficiency. There is no evidence that "fluoxetine + magnesium" exists as a single fixed-dose combination product; rather, this refers to their concurrent use. Some clinical studies have explored whether adding magnesium supplementation to standard fluoxetine therapy may improve outcomes in depression. One small double-blind study found no significant difference between fluoxetine plus magnesium versus fluoxetine plus placebo on depression scores overall but suggested that certain patient characteristics (such as lower baseline depression scores or female gender) might increase the odds of remission when treatment was augmented with magnesium[5]. No major pharmacokinetic interactions are reported between these agents[2][6], though some sources note that therapeutic efficacy could be affected when combined[6]. Caution should always be exercised when combining supplements with prescription medications due to potential for unstudied interactions[4][7].
